Ted Nugent Screaming Again, This Time Over Obama
Well, Ted Nugent, who is famous for his songs, "Stranglehold" and "Cat Scratch Fever", is in hot water with President Barack Obama's Administration. He is having a meeting with the Secret Service Agents next week, to discuss his comments at the most recent NRA (National Rifle Association) meeting.
He is quoted as calling this administration an "evil, America-hating administration" and urged NRA members to "to ride into that battlefield and chop their heads off in November."
Nugent also said if Obama were re-elected, "I will either be dead or in jail by this time next year."
Obviously, the administration took his latter comment as a threat to President Obama's safety. They believed, probably, that he was incinuating that he would harm President Obama. It sounds like it; although, he could be saying that he would lose it and go crazy doing something illegal... not necessarily assassination.
And what if he is threatening him? I've heard people say things exactly like that, and I knew darn well what they were saying... He better be glad he's having an open meeting with Secret Service Agents and not a hidden meeting with the CIA. What did he mean, exactly? We might never know.
Ted Nugent is well-known for his outspoken ways which you can witness in the many reality shows he's appeared in... One was a 2-hour show on VH1, where he hosted, called "Surviving Nugent" where Tila Tequila moves in to see if she can make it in the backwoods life. This show split off into a 4-part series where he actually injures himself with a chainsaw requiring 44 stitches.
Ted Nugent speaks out against issues such as: obesity, public healthcare and higher taxes and has played his guitar at the Alamo at the Tax Day Tea Party.
Basically, you either love or hate the guy... there is no middle ground here. He has quite a fan base, but let's see who's against him after this public stunt.

Giuliana Rancic has breast cancer?


“Instead of radiation, I’m going to go ahead and move forward,“ Rancic -- flanked by her husband Bill -- told Ann Curry about the procedure, in which both of her breasts will be surgically removed.
Rancic, who’s been public about her desire to have a child, said alternative treatments would have put her into early menopause, but that’s not the factor spurring the bold decision.
“To be honest, at the end, all it came down to was choosing to live and not looking over my shoulder the rest of my life,” she said.
Bill, 40, kept a strong demeanor as he explained the technical aspects of their decision.
“We were faced with a decision to make ... this wasn’t a decision that was made lightly, we talked to as many experts as we could ... in this particular case, this is the best option for Giuliana.”
The E! host, 37, said the procedure will leave her with a less-than-1 percent chance of the cancer returning. She said Bill inspirationally told her, “I just need you around for the next 50 years, kid -- I don’t care what you look like ... so let’s just get you healthy” which bolstered her decision to go for the procedure.
She went into further detail about how her husband has helped her through the process.
“Bill has been the world to me through this,” she continued. “I couldn't have done it without Bill. Even right from the beginning, when we found out we had the option about mastectomy, we went in the backyard and I remember -- in typical Bill fashion -- he pulled out a yellow legal pad and made a pros and cons list of the mastectomy.
“And he just -- he brought some laughter to the process, some light to it and just kept reminding me who we are as a couple and that none of this is going to break us apart or get us down or affect our love for each other. In fact, it's just made it stronger and I couldn't be more at peace with the decision, but it was hard, and I still break down some nights when it's quiet in bed.
“It's easy to just start crying and be very sad,” Giuliana said, “but I'm OK.”
The supportive spouse said he’s focused on the finish line, adding he hopes the cancer scare will be over by the holidays.
Other celebrity cancer survivors who’ve undergone the harrowing procedure include Christina Applegate, Wanda Sykes and Ann Jillian.
No more Oreos or Jamba Juice? Venus is aspiring to have a better diet in 2012

No more Oreos or Jamba Juice? Venus is aspiring to have a better diet in 2012.
A tall order for the taller sister. Can the meat-and-potatoes Wimbledon-queen summon her past success as a leaner and greener player?
Older sister Venus, who’s claimed five titles at the All England Club, is having a health scare of her own after being diagnosed with Sjogren’s Syndrome, an autoimmune disease, which can lead to damage of the body’s vital organs. The illness forced her drop out of the US Open this year and has pushed meat out of her diet.
Despite the seriousness of the condition, Venus has been sporting a positive attitude and even healthier eating habits. She told reporters, “I changed my diet completely, so lots of vegetables. I [altered] my mind frame completely because I was the person who always ate their steak first and their salad second.”
Times are changing for the superstar, who said last year that she “eats to live and not lives to eat.” She continued talking foodie favorites, saying that she considered “beans and rice and blackened chicken” a top meal choice.
Venus discussed her new diet’s impact on the future. “My goal next year is to play a full schedule. It will take some work to get there, but I’m no stranger to hard work.”
Murray aside, Venus’ newfound form and fitness will no doubt have fans worldwide salivating for a dominating force in an otherwise floundering WTA. Petra Kvitova, 21, the current world No. 2 and winner of Wimbledon and the Season Ending Championships, might be the answer. She’s still, however, young and half-baked in terms of talent and poise.
It’s time for Venus to turn up the burners and bring back the motivation for which she’s known. Currently ranked No. 103, having only played a handful of tournaments this year, Venus quickly doused rumors of retirement.
“I love the game. The racket feels right in my hand and I’m planning on going right back to where I was at the top of the rankings in the singles and doubles.”
With Venus back in-shape and on form, the alarm bells should be sounding for the rest of the women’s tour. It’ll be tough to get out of the fire and back into the figurative frying pan that is professional tennis at her ripe age of 31. But if anyone can come back from adversity and succeed, it’s a Williams.
